Dies ist der Befehl dcmstack, der beim kostenlosen Hosting-Anbieter OnWorks mit einer unserer zahlreichen kostenlosen Online-Workstations wie Ubuntu Online, Fedora Online, dem Windows-Online-Emulator oder dem MAC OS-Online-Emulator ausgeführt werden kann
PROGRAMM:
NAME/FUNKTION
dcmstack – DICOM-zu-NIfTI-Konverter
BESCHREIBUNG
Verwendung: dcmstack [-h] [--force-read] [--file-ext FILE_EXT] [--allow-dummies]
[--dest-dir DEST_DIR] [-o OUTPUT_NAME] [--output-ext OUTPUT_EXT] [-d]
[--embed-meta] [-g GROUP_BY] [--voxel-order VOXEL_ORDER] [-t TIME_VAR]
[--vector-var VECTOR_VAR] [--time-order TIME_ORDER] [--vector-order VECTOR_ORDER]
[-l] [--disable-translator DISABLE_TRANSLATOR] [--extract-private] [-i
INCLUDE_REGEX] [-e EXCLUDE_REGEX] [--default-regexes] [-v] [--strict] [--version]
[src_dirs [src_dirs ...]]
Stapeln Sie DICOM-Dateien aus jedem Quellverzeichnis in 2D- bis 5D-Volumen und extrahieren Sie sie optional
Metadaten.
positionell Argumente:
src_dirs
Die Quellverzeichnisse, die DICOM-Dateien enthalten.
optional Argumente:
-h, --help
Diese Hilfemeldung anzeigen und beenden
zufuhr Optionen:
--force-read
Versuchen Sie, alle Dateien als DICOM zu lesen, auch wenn ihnen die Präambel fehlt.
--file-ext DATEI_EXT
Versuchen Sie nur, Dateien mit der angegebenen Erweiterung zu lesen. Standard: .dcm
--allow-dummies
Lassen Sie DICOM-Dateien zu, bei denen Pixeldaten fehlen und diesen Teil der Ausgabe ausfüllen
nifti mit dem maximal darstellbaren Wert.
Output Optionen:
--dest-dir DEST_DIR
Zielverzeichnis, standardmäßig das Quellverzeichnis.
-o OUTPUT_NAME, --Ausgabename OUTPUT_NAME
Python-Formatzeichenfolge, die die Ausgabedateinamen basierend auf DICOM-Tags bestimmt.
--output-ext OUTPUT_EXT
Die Erweiterung für den Ausgabedateityp. Standard: .nii.gz
-d, --dump-meta
Speichern Sie die extrahierten Metadaten in einer JSON-Datei mit demselben Basisnamen wie die
Nifti generiert
--embed-meta
Betten Sie die extrahierten Metadaten in eine Nifti-Header-Erweiterung ein (im JSON-Format).
Stacking Zubehör:
-g GRUPPIERE NACH, --gruppiere nach GRUPPIERE NACH
Durch Kommas getrennte Liste von Metadatenschlüsseln, mit denen Eingabedateien in Stapeln gruppiert werden.
--voxel-order VOXEL_ORDER
Ordnen Sie die Voxel so, dass die räumlichen Indizes im Patienten von diesen Richtungen ausgehen
Raum. Die Anweisungen im Patientenbereich sollten als dreistelliger Code angegeben werden:
(l)eft, (r)right, (a)nterior, (p)osterior, (s)oben, (i)nferior. Ein Leerzeichen übergeben
string wird die Neuausrichtung deaktivieren. Standard: LAS
-t TIME_VAR, --time-var TIME_VAR
Das Schlüsselwort des DICOM-Elements, das zum Ordnen des Stapels entlang der Zeitdimension verwendet werden soll.
--vector-var VECTOR_VAR
Das Schlüsselwort des DICOM-Elements, das zum Ordnen des Stapels entlang der Vektordimension verwendet werden soll.
--time-order TIME_ORDER
Geben Sie eine Textdatei mit der gewünschten Reihenfolge für die Werte (einen pro Zeile) an
Attribut, das als Zeitvariable verwendet wird. Diese Option wird selten benötigt.
--vector-order VECTOR_ORDER
Geben Sie eine Textdatei mit der gewünschten Reihenfolge für die Werte (einen pro Zeile) an
Attribut, das als Vektorvariable verwendet wird. Diese Option wird selten benötigt.
Meta Extrahierung und Filterung Zubehör:
-l, --list-translators
Aktivierte Übersetzer auflisten und beenden
--disable-translator DISABLE_TRANSLATOR
Deaktivieren Sie die Übersetzer für die bereitgestellten Tags. Tags sollten im Format angegeben werden
„0x0_0x0“. In einer durch Kommas getrennten Liste können mehrere angegeben werden. Wenn das Wort „alle“
bereitgestellt wird, werden alle Übersetzer deaktiviert.
--extract-private
Extrahieren Sie Metadaten aus privaten Elementen, auch wenn kein Übersetzer vorhanden ist. Wenn die
Wenn der Wert für das Element Nicht-ASCII-Bytes enthält, wird er dennoch ignoriert. Der
Extrahierte Metadaten können weiterhin durch die regulären Ausdrücke herausgefiltert werden.
-i INCLUDE_REGEX, --include-regex INCLUDE_REGEX
Fügen Sie alle Metadaten ein, bei denen der Schlüssel mit dem bereitgestellten regulären Ausdruck übereinstimmt. Das
überschreibt alle Ausschlussausdrücke. Gilt für alle Metadaten.
-e EXCLUDE_REGEX, --exclude-regex EXCLUDE_REGEX
Schließen Sie alle Metadaten aus, bei denen der Schlüssel mit dem bereitgestellten regulären Ausdruck übereinstimmt. Das
ergänzt die standardmäßigen Ausschlussausdrücke. Gilt für alle Metadaten.
--default-regexes
Drucken Sie die Liste der standardmäßigen Ein- und Ausschlüsse regulärer Ausdrücke aus und beenden Sie sie.
Allgemeines Zubehör:
-v, - ausführlich
Zusätzliche Informationen ausdrucken.
--strikt
Bei der ersten Ausnahme fehlschlagen, anstatt eine Warnung anzuzeigen.
--Version
Version anzeigen und beenden.
Es liegt in Ihrer Verantwortung zu wissen, ob die Metadaten private Gesundheitsinformationen enthalten
VON DIESEM PROGRAMM EXTRAHIERT.
Nutzen Sie dcmstack online über die Dienste von onworks.net